    What are marigold aura nails?

    Marigold aura nails use a warm orange-yellow center that diffuses into a peach, nude, or translucent perimeter. The gradient resembles a soft halo rather than a hard circle. A glossy finish keeps the warm colors bright and makes the transition look smoother.

    Why the color works in late summer

    Marigold sits between yellow and orange, so it echoes late-summer flowers, peaches, sunsets, and sun-warmed neutrals. Unlike neon lemon, it has enough warmth to pair with denim, tan leather, cream linen, and earthy green.

    The aura gradient also gives the eye two related colors instead of one opaque yellow. If your skin has warm or neutral undertones, peach edges can create a gentle transition. Cooler undertones may prefer a cleaner yellow center fading into translucent pink rather than orange.

    Three versions to consider

    Peach-to-marigold aura

    This is the softest version and the one shown in the original images. Keep the yellow concentrated near the center and let peach remain visible at the edge.

    Marigold French tips

    A warm yellow tip over a sheer base is simpler for short nails. Make the line thin if you want a minimal look, or slightly deeper at the corners for a rounded retro effect.

    Golden cat-eye accent

    Use a magnetic gold or yellow-green effect on one accent nail beside creamy marigold. This adds movement but still preserves the warm color story.

    How to create a soft aura gradient

    Dabbing marigold color onto the center of a peach nail with a small sponge
    Build the center slowly; several light dabs are easier to control than one saturated press.
    1. Prepare the nails and apply the compatible base steps specified by the gel system.
    2. Add a thin peach or sheer warm-nude color and cure as directed.
    3. Place a small amount of marigold gel on a clean palette.
    4. Pick up very little color with a small sponge and dab the center of the nail.
    5. Blend outward with lighter pressure, keeping the perimeter softer.
    6. Repeat only if more depth is needed, curing each layer according to the product instructions.
    7. Seal with the compatible topcoat.

    Do not allow gel-soaked sponge material to touch the surrounding skin. If the color reaches the skin, clean it according to the product safety instructions before curing.

    Frequently asked questions

    Is marigold the same as butter yellow?

    No. Butter yellow is pale and creamy. Marigold is warmer, deeper, and closer to golden yellow with an orange undertone.

    Can aura nails be done without an airbrush?

    Yes. A small sponge can create a soft center, although the texture and blend may differ from an airbrush result. Work in thin layers and follow gel safety directions.

    Do marigold nails work in fall?

    They can. A peach-marigold gradient feels summery, while pairing marigold with brown, olive, or deeper orange shifts it toward early fall.
